Latest Patents

One of Gregory's key inventions is a desiccant cartridge with an elongated center tube. This invention relates to desiccant cartridges utilized in receiver/drier (R/D) or accumulator canisters of automotive air conditioning systems. Specifically, it features a cup with inner and outer walls that are coaxially disposed, where the inner wall defines an elongated center tube with opposing first and second ends. The first end of the center tube communicates with the outlet port in an R/D or accumulator canister, effectively eliminating the need for a fluid flow tube used in traditional designs.
